Junior Service League donates $12,533 for new swings at JSL Park in Lake Jackson
Representatives of the Junior Service League of Brazosport presented a $12,533 donation to the City of Lake Jackson on Oct. 20 to fund installation of new swings at JSL Park. The donation supplements a $5,000 grant the group received and follows prior volunteer work by the group on park maintenance, gazebo upkeep and the recently completed restroom at the site.

At the meeting the presenter said the league coordinates workdays with the city’s parks and recreation department for mowing, mulching and tree work and that swings have been absent at the park for a long time. Council members and staff thanked the volunteers for their work and for funding the equipment. No formal council action was required; the presentation was recorded as a ceremonial donation on the meeting record.

The Junior Service League of Brazosport is listed in the transcript as the presenting organization; city staff noted the park’s popularity and that the new swings and other amenities are expected to increase public use.
